John Verrico
Journalist, stand-up comic, janitor, theater performer, electronics technician, business consultant, disco dance instructor. John Verrico still doesn't know what he wants to be when he grows up but learned not to take life too seriously and to experience everything life has to offer. Former president of the National Association of Government Communicators and Navy Master Chief, John retired from 42 years as a communication professional in media, community, and employee relations. As founder of Share Your Fire, John is now a high-energy, thought-provoking, and humorously nerdy international speaker and leadership coach. He is an eight-time international best-selling contributing author and holds a Masters degree in Organizational Leadership, and a Bachelors in Communication.
